CABRERA IZQUIERDO, Lorena Elizabeth y MEDINA TURIZO, María Genobelia. Penal responsibility for the minor native of Mokaná jurisdiction on the Caribe Colombia’s. Justicia [online]. 2022, vol.27, n.41, pp.31-42. Epub 30-Jun-2022. ISSN 0124-7441. https://doi.org/10.17081/just.27.41.5060.
The objective of this research is to make known that in the Colombian State, with the promulgation of the Constitution of 1991, the indigenous Mokaná have achieved the recognition of their own jurisdiction, the Special Indigenous Jurisdiction. The methodology used is qualitative and socio-legal, with a historical-hermeneutic approach, the data collection technique was the design of a script for the discussion group. Results and conclusion: in the study, Mokaná indigenous adolescents, as a consequence of cultural hybridization, are judged according to the norms and procedures of the Juvenile legislation.
